Effects of low-level laser therapy on symptomatic calcific rotator cuff tendinopathy : A prospective randomized controlled study

Yasemin Tombak et al. Wien Klin Wochenschr. .

Abstract

Objective: Rotator cuff calcific tendinitis (RCCT) is a benign but incapacitating condition and in some patients it is the cause of chronic debilitating pain and functional disability. We aimed to reveal the short-term effects of low-level laser therapy (LLLT) on clinical and sonographic parameters in patients with symptomatic RCCT.

Method: This prospective randomized controlled study analyzed 76 painful shoulders of 68 patients aged 18-75 years, with over 3 months of shoulder pain and where RCCT was confirmed sonographically. Patients in the LLLT group (received 5 LLLT sessions per week and home exercises for 5 days/week for 3 weeks) and the control group (received home exercises, 5 days/week for 3 weeks) were assessed clinically and sonographically just before and after treatment, recording pain intensity, range of motion (ROM), shoulder functional status, location (supraspinatus/infraspinatus, subscapularis), number and degree of calcification. Degree of calcification was determined with ultrasound and classified by the Bianchi-Martinoli classification. The LLLT was applied to the calcified areas marked under ultrasound guidance.

Results: Both groups showed statistically significant improvements in ROM, pain intensity, shoulder pain and disability index (SPADI) pain/disability/total, and degree of calcification after treatment. No significant change was achieved for calcification in the control group. Considering the change values, improvements in abduction, extension, pain intensity, SPADI pain/disability/total, calcification number, and calcification degree parameters were found to be statistically significantly better in the LLLT group than in the control group.

Conclusion: Adding LLLT to the home program in treatment of symptomatic RCCT outperformed the home program alone, reducing the number and severity of calcifications, improving pain and disability.
